A diversity of opinions can provide a new perspective on problems and solutions. Learning environments that provide opportunities for open discussions facilitate exposure to diverse opinions. Unrestricted and unlimited sharing of opinions can generate new ideas. The principal activity that enables open discussion in Moodle is a Discussion Forum, and especially the types called Standard forum for general use and Simple single discussion. In learning environments with many participants open discussions can be highly active. Good facilitation skills are needed to steer and guide participants. Moodle offers several options for following discussions, such as email notifications of new posts (Subscription) or tracking of unread posts (Read tracking), and to help reward good contributions, Ratings. These and other topics will be covered in this section.
